What is a verifiable credential?
A verifiable credential is an electronic version of a document (like an ID card, diploma, or membership) that you can store in a digital wallet and share with others to prove something about yourself — such as your age, education, or qualifications — in a secure and trustworthy way.
What are the minimum device requirements?
To ensure secure and reliable use of the wallet, your device must meet the following minimum requirements:
General Requirements
-
Minimum supported OS version (refer to the latest in the app store)
-
Biometric authentication enabled (e.g. fingerprint or face unlock)
iOS Devices
-
Device must not be jailbroken
-
Latest official iOS version recommended
Android Devices
-
Bootloader must be locked
-
Device must not be rooted
-
App must be installed via the Google Play Store
-
Device must run a Google-certified operating system (Note: Custom ROMs such as GrapheneOS are not supported)
-
Device must have installed a security update within the past 12 months
-
Google Play Protect must be activated
What happens if I uninstall the wallet?
Uninstalling the wallet will definitely remove the verifiable credentials stored in the wallet.
What happens if I lose my phone?
If you lose your phone, nobody will be able to access your credentials since the wallet is secured by your biometric. Nevertheless, a good practice is to reset the device remotely if possible, or to revoke individual credentials by contacting credential’s issuer.
Can I freely move my credentials to new phone?
The most precious credentials, e.g. bank account credential, are bound to your device. This means that if you install the Wallet on your new phone you will have to ask the credential’s issuer to issue a new credential to your new phone. Less sensitive credentials, such as some membership cards, could be transferred from one device to another if the credential’s issuer allows it.
